Web5 dec. 2003 · Rooting should occur in 6 to 8 weeks. When the pineapple has developed a good root system, carefully remove it from the rooting medium. Plant the rooted pineapple in a light, well-drained potting mix. Water well. Then place the plant in bright, indirect light for 2 or 3 weeks.
